Pair 1 · Same Frame, Different Cushion

AirFit F20 vs AirTouch F20

AirFit F20
VS
AirTouch F20

Why people confuse them: they're literally the same mask — same frame, same headgear, same box shape on the shelf. The only difference is one word in the name.

AirFit F20
InfinitySeal™ Silicone Cushion
✓ Durable silicone, easy daily wash
✓ Cushion lasts 1–3 months
✓ Best for everyday reliability

AirTouch F20
UltraSoft™ Memory Foam Cushion
✓ Extra-soft, gentler on sensitive skin
✓ Wipe clean only, replace ~monthly
✓ Best for maximum comfort

Because the frame is shared, cushions are interchangeable — you can own one mask and swap between silicone and memory foam depending on the night. Read the full AirFit F20 vs AirTouch F20 comparison for the complete breakdown.

Pair 2 · Different Masks, Confusingly Close Numbers

AirFit N20 vs AirFit N30i

AirFit N20
VS
AirFit N30i

Why people confuse them: "N20" and "N30i" look like two versions of the same product line. They're actually two completely different mask designs.

AirFit N20
Traditional Nasal Mask
✓ Front-mounted tube connection
✓ InfinitySeal™ cushion covers the nose
✓ Dependable seal at higher pressures

AirFit N30i
Nasal Cradle Mask
✓ Top-of-head tube connection
✓ Cushion sits under the nose, not over it
✓ Best for side sleepers, open field of vision

Choose N20 if…
You want a proven, everyday nasal mask and don't mind the hose sitting in front of your face.
Choose N30i if…
You sleep on your side or move a lot, and want the hose completely out of the way.
Pair 3 · Same Letter, Same Coverage, Different Tube

AirFit F20 vs AirFit F30i

AirFit F20
VS
AirFit F30i

Why people confuse them: both are full face masks starting with "F", both cover nose and mouth, and both show up next to each other in search results.

AirFit F20
Full Coverage, Front Tube
✓ Traditional front-mounted tube
✓ Full silicone cushion seal
✓ Reliable at higher pressures

AirFit F30i
Minimal Contact, Top-of-Head Tube
✓ Top-of-head tube connection
✓ Under-the-nose cushion, more open feel
✓ Built for side and active sleepers

Frequently Asked Questions

Quick answers before you buy.

What's the actual difference between AirFit F20 and AirTouch F20?+
They share the identical frame and headgear — the only difference is the cushion. AirFit F20 uses InfinitySeal silicone, while AirTouch F20 uses UltraSoft memory foam. Cushions are interchangeable between the two.
Is AirFit N30i the same as AirFit N20?+
No, they're different mask families. The AirFit N20 is a traditional nasal mask with front-mounted tubing that seals around the nose. The AirFit N30i is a nasal cradle mask with a top-of-head tube connection that sits under the nose rather than over it.
What's the difference between AirFit F20 and AirFit F30i?+
Both are full face masks, but the tube connects differently. AirFit F20 has a traditional front-mounted tube. AirFit F30i has a top-of-head tube connection with a more minimal-contact cushion, generally better suited to side sleepers.
Can I switch cushions between AirFit and AirTouch masks?+
Where the frame is shared — such as AirFit F20 and AirTouch F20, or AirFit N30i and AirFit P30i — cushions are generally interchangeable, letting you try a different material or style without buying an entirely new mask.
